Job Description:

The Wireless Solutions Group is seeking an experienced Senior Engineer I - Design  for our next generation high-performance, low-power wireless SoC and attach solutions. The role will include driving and optimizing synthesis, constraints, formal equivalence checks, power optimization, and static timing analysis using an industry leading SOC design flow. Successful candidate requires strong collaboration across sites and functions, excellent communication, and the ability to thrive in a fast-paced, dynamic environment.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Candidate will provide hands on technical contribution to the WSG Silicon Development Team in the area of design implementation.
  • Drive and optimize Synthesis, Formal, constraints, power optimization and STA for Microchip’s wireless SoC development.
  • Work closely with digital, analog, and physical design teams to optimize front-end (RTL-to-Netlist) implementation for performance, power, and area.
  • Drive front-end low power implementation and optimization using UPF.
  • Familiarity with multi-mode and corner timing closure, Signal integrity and noise analysis flows.
  • Previous experience with Microcontroller design is desirable.
  • Continuously improve RTL-to-Netlist tool flows and methodologies.
  • Interfacing with external vendors and IP sources to resolve problems.
  • Ability to work well in a team and excellent problem solving, verbal and written communication skills.
  • Working with members from international design and implementation teams

    Requirements/Qualifications:

    • Bachelor’s in an engineering discipline plus 5+ years of experience or a Master’s in an engineering discipline plus 2.5 years of experience.
    • Expertise in Synthesis, Formal Verification and Static Timing Analysis, using industry leading tools.
    • Familiarity with Verilog, Verilog simulation, and debug.
    • Familiarity with Tcl, Perl, Python, and Shell scripting.
    • Solid understanding of digital implementation tools and flow
    • Good Communication and teamwork skills
    • Fluent in both written and spoken English
    • Knowledge and exposure to complete Silicon Tapeout flow is desired
